mx linux
mx linux

Linux has become a go-to operating system for users seeking more control, security, and customization in their computing experience. While there are countless Linux distributions to choose from, some stand out for their balance of performance, user-friendliness, and versatility. One such distribution that has gained significant traction in recent years is MX Linux.

MX Linux is widely praised for being lightweight, stable, and easy to use, making it ideal for both Linux newcomers and experienced users alike. Whether you’re looking to revive an old computer or build a new system that’s both resource-efficient and customizable, MX Linux is a compelling choice. In this blog post, we will dive deep into what MX Linux is, why it’s popular, its features, how to install it, and why it might just be the right Linux distribution for you.


Table of Contents

  1. What is MX Linux?
  2. History and Development of MX Linux
  3. Why Choose MX Linux?
  4. Key Features of MX Linux
  5. System Requirements
  6. Installing MX Linux
  7. MX Linux Tools and Utilities
  8. Performance and User Experience
  9. Community and Support
  10. Final Thoughts: Is MX Linux Right for You?

1. What is MX Linux?

MX Linux is a Debian-based, midweight Linux distribution that aims to provide a fast, stable, and user-friendly desktop environment. It is known for its efficient use of system resources, making it an excellent choice for older computers or systems with limited hardware. MX Linux combines the simplicity and stability of Debian with a set of unique tools and features that enhance the user experience.

The default desktop environment of MX Linux is XFCE, known for being lightweight and highly customizable. However, versions of MX Linux with KDE Plasma and Fluxbox are also available, catering to users with different tastes in desktop environments.


2. History and Development of MX Linux

MX Linux was developed as a collaborative project between two communities: antiX and Mepis. The first official release, MX-14, was launched in March 2014. The idea was to combine the best elements of both distributions:

  • Mepis Linux: A Debian-based distro focused on providing a user-friendly desktop environment with out-of-the-box functionality.
  • antiX: A lightweight Linux distribution designed to run on very low-end or older hardware, with an emphasis on speed and efficiency.

The collaboration between these two projects resulted in a distribution that retained the user-friendliness of Mepis while incorporating the lightweight nature of antiX. Over the years, MX Linux has grown in popularity, climbing to the top of Distrowatch’s rankings and gaining a dedicated following.


3. Why Choose MX Linux?

There are numerous reasons why MX Linux has earned its place as one of the most popular Linux distributions. Let’s explore a few:

1. Resource Efficiency

MX Linux is known for being extremely lightweight. It’s optimized to run on older hardware without sacrificing modern functionality. The XFCE desktop environment is sleek, fast, and consumes minimal system resources compared to other environments like GNOME or KDE.

2. User-Friendly

Unlike some Linux distributions that require advanced knowledge to configure or use, MX Linux is designed to be approachable. Whether you’re a Linux beginner or a seasoned pro, MX Linux offers an intuitive experience with its MX Tools suite, which simplifies many system administration tasks.

3. Stability and Reliability

Based on Debian Stable, MX Linux inherits the reliability and security of one of the most trusted Linux distributions. Debian Stable is known for its rigorous testing and commitment to providing stable and secure software, making MX Linux a dependable daily driver.

4. Customizability

Although lightweight and simple by default, MX Linux is highly customizable. From desktop themes to system settings, users can tweak almost every aspect of the system to fit their preferences. The XFCE desktop, in particular, is known for its flexibility and low resource usage.

5. Great Performance

One of the primary selling points of MX Linux is its performance. Thanks to its lightweight nature, MX Linux boots quickly, runs smoothly, and performs exceptionally well even on older or resource-constrained machines. This makes it an ideal choice for users looking to breathe new life into older computers.

6. Active Community and Support

MX Linux benefits from an active and vibrant community. Its forums, documentation, and community-driven support ensure that help is readily available for new and experienced users alike. The developers actively engage with users, taking feedback into account to improve future releases.


4. Key Features of MX Linux

Let’s take a look at some of the standout features that MX Linux brings to the table:

1. MX Tools

One of the defining features of MX Linux is its suite of custom tools known as MX Tools. These utilities make managing and configuring the system easier for users. Some popular MX Tools include:

  • MX Snapshot: Create a live ISO snapshot of your installed system for backup or sharing.
  • MX Package Installer: A graphical package installer that makes it easy to install software from a variety of sources, including Flatpaks and backports.
  • MX Tweak: Adjust system settings and tweak the desktop environment to your liking with a simple interface.
  • MX Boot Options: Configure boot parameters and options without needing to edit configuration files manually.
  • MX Conky Manager: Customize Conky, the lightweight system monitor, with a simple graphical interface.

2. Pre-installed Applications

MX Linux comes pre-installed with a wide variety of useful applications, including:

  • Firefox for web browsing.
  • LibreOffice for office productivity.
  • VLC for multimedia playback.
  • GIMP for image editing.
  • Thunderbird for email management.

These pre-installed apps mean that MX Linux works out of the box for most users without requiring them to spend time hunting down essential software.

3. Debian Stable Base

MX Linux is built on Debian Stable, known for its rock-solid reliability, security, and wide software availability. Debian’s conservative release cycle ensures that the system remains stable over long periods of time, making MX Linux ideal for both desktop and server environments.

4. Live USB with Persistence

MX Linux can be run as a live USB with persistence, meaning you can run the system without installing it to your hard drive and still save your settings and files. This is especially useful for testing the OS, troubleshooting, or using it on different computers without installation.

5. Hardware Compatibility

Thanks to its Debian roots and the wide array of included drivers, MX Linux boasts excellent hardware compatibility. It supports a broad range of hardware configurations, from newer machines to older laptops and desktops, with little to no manual driver configuration.


5. System Requirements

One of the main reasons for MX Linux’s popularity is its low system requirements. This makes it an excellent choice for older or less powerful machines. The basic requirements for MX Linux are:

  • Processor: A modern i686 Intel or AMD processor. Older processors are also supported.
  • RAM: 1GB of RAM is the minimum, but 2GB or more is recommended for a smoother experience.
  • Hard Drive Space: At least 5GB of free disk space for installation. More is needed depending on the software you plan to install.
  • Display: A screen resolution of 1024×768 or higher is recommended.

Even with these modest requirements, MX Linux is capable of handling a wide variety of tasks, from web browsing to multimedia playback and office productivity.


6. Installing MX Linux

Installing MX Linux is a straightforward process that takes just a few steps. Here’s a quick overview:

1. Download the ISO

Head over to the official MX Linux website and download the ISO for the latest version of MX Linux. You can choose between the XFCE, KDE, and Fluxbox versions, depending on your desktop environment preference.

2. Create a Bootable USB

You’ll need a USB drive (at least 4GB) to create a bootable installer. Tools like Rufus (for Windows) or Etcher (for Linux and macOS) can be used to create the bootable USB from the MX Linux ISO.

3. Boot from the USB

Insert the USB into the computer where you want to install MX Linux, and boot from the USB. Most systems allow you to select the boot device by pressing a key like F12 or Esc during startup.

4. Run the Installer

Once you boot into the MX Linux live environment, you’ll see an option to install MX Linux. Follow the on-screen instructions to select your hard drive, partitioning scheme, and user settings.

5. Complete Installation

After installation, reboot your system and remove the USB. MX Linux will now boot from your hard drive. You can start customizing your desktop and installing any additional software you need.


7. MX Linux Tools and Utilities

MX Linux comes with several custom utilities designed to simplify various administrative tasks. Here’s a closer look at some of the most useful MX Tools:

  • MX Snapshot: Create a live ISO of your current system, including installed applications and configurations. This is great for backups or sharing a personalized version of MX Linux.
  • MX Tweak: Adjust desktop settings, panel layout, and compositor settings with ease.
  • MX Conky Manager: Use this to configure Conky, a system monitor that displays real-time system information on your desktop.
  • MX Package Installer: A user-friendly package manager that makes it easy to install software from Debian Stable, Flatpaks, or MX Linux’s own repositories.

8. Performance and User Experience

MX Linux is designed for high performance, particularly on older hardware. The default XFCE desktop environment is lightweight, which means the system runs efficiently with low memory usage. The inclusion of useful pre-installed applications and MX Tools makes it functional out of the box, reducing the need for extensive post-installation configuration.

In terms of user experience, MX Linux strikes a balance between simplicity and customizability. New users can get started easily thanks to the straightforward interface, while advanced users will appreciate the control and flexibility that MX Linux offers.


9. Community and Support

MX Linux enjoys a strong, active community. Its forums are filled with helpful users ready to answer questions and provide troubleshooting tips. In addition to community support, MX Linux has excellent documentation, including a user manual and wiki, that covers most aspects of the system.


10. Final Thoughts: Is MX Linux Right for You?

MX Linux is a versatile, reliable, and user-friendly distribution that has something to offer for almost every type of user. Whether you’re looking to revive an old computer, build a lightweight and efficient system, or explore Linux for the first time, MX Linux is an excellent choice. Its balance of performance, simplicity, and customizability, combined with strong community support, makes it one of the best Linux distributions available today.

If you want a fast, stable, and hassle-free Linux experience, MX Linux could be the perfect fit for your needs.

Leave a Reply

Your email address will not be published. Required fields are marked *